What is the 90-Day Thai Visa?

The 90-day Thai Visa is a non-immigrant visa that allows foreign nationals to enter and stay in Thailand for up to 90 days. It's typically issued for various purposes, including:   

  • Business: Conducting business activities in Thailand.   
  • Work: Obtaining a work permit in Thailand.   
  • Study: Pursuing academic or vocational studies.   
  • Family visits: Visiting family members residing in Thailand.   
  • Retirement: For individuals who meet specific criteria.

Key Requirements:

  • Valid passport: Ensure your passport has sufficient validity beyond your intended stay in Thailand.
  • Visa application form: Complete the application form accurately and truthfully.
  • Passport-sized photos: Provide recent photographs meeting specific requirements.   
  • Proof of funds: Demonstrate sufficient financial means to support your stay in Thailand.   
  • Travel itinerary: Present a detailed itinerary of your planned activities in Thailand.   
  • Return or onward travel ticket: Book a return or onward flight ticket.
  • Health insurance: Some visa categories may require proof of health insurance coverage.   
  • Supporting documents: Depending on the purpose of your visit, you may need additional documents such as:
    • Invitation letter: If visiting family or friends.
    • Letter from your employer: If traveling for business.
    • Admission letter: If studying in Thailand.

Application Process:

  • Apply at the nearest Thai Embassy or Consulate: Submit your application in person or through a designated agent.
  • Pay the visa fee: The visa fee varies depending on your nationality.   
  • Wait for processing: Processing times can vary, so plan accordingly.   

Important Notes:

  • Visa validity: The 90-day visa is valid for a specific period from the date of issuance.   
  • Extensions: In some cases, you may be able to extend your stay beyond 90 days, but this requires approval from Thai immigration authorities.   
  • Overstay penalties: Overstaying your visa can result in fines and potential legal consequences.
